WhatsApp Pegasus Spyware Attack (2019) One of the most famous zero-day exploits happened on WhatsApp in 2019. Hackers discovered a vulnerability in WhatsApp’s call feature, allowing them to install spyware on phones without the user’s knowledge. Even if the user didn’t answer the call, spyware called Pegasus was installed.

Spyware – malware that spies on the computer to collect the information about a product, a company, a person. The most widespread spyware are keyloggers and trojans. Account Hijacking – a type of identitytheft, when a hacker hacks and steals someone’s account to perform malicious actions.

MoleRats has been known to try to woo victims, including members of the Israel Defense Forces, into infecting their devices with spyware by impersonating women on messaging apps and then sending a malicious link – supposedly for watching videos or for downloading a photo-sharing app where they could exchange provocative images.
The Makoob family moved from eighth to third place (3.96%), displacing the Noon spyware (3.62%), which collects browser passwords and keystrokes. Next in line were Strab spyware Trojans (2.85%), capable of tracking keystrokes, taking screenshots, and performing other typical spyware actions.
